The FINANCIAL — Best, the Netherlands – Royal Philips launched EmboGuide, its latest innovation in interventional oncology, to treat difficult-to-reach tumors or tumors in patients who are deemed unsuitable for surgery, according to Koninklijke Philips N.V.
EmboGuide is a live 3D image guidance tool that supports the increasing number of minimally-invasive procedures. It is designed for use in conjunction with Philips’ interventional X-ray system to perform tumor embolization procedures. Such procedures involve blocking the arteries feeding a tumor to deprive it of nutrients and oxygen. They require the insertion of a catheter, which must be guided to the tumor site with the aid of live image-guidance.
Developed in collaboration with leading clinicians and partners such as BTG, an innovator in interventional oncology, EmboGuide addresses the need for an enhanced 3D imaging solution to make interventional oncology procedures more effective and easier to perform, and ultimately improve patient outcomes. It offers interventional radiologists the ability to visualize and characterize tumor lesions and plan and execute interventional procedures, according to Koninklijke Philips N.V.

A specific example of a tumor embolization procedure is transarterial chemo-embolization (TACE), used for palliative treatment of liver tumors. It involves simultaneous local administration of chemotherapy and beads that block the arteries feeding the liver tumor.
“We can only treat what we see, yet the embolization of all blood vessels that feed the liver tumor lesion is key for an effective TACE procedure,” said Shiro Miyayama, MD, Department of Diagnostic Radiology, Fukuiken Saisekai Hospital, Japan. “EmboGuide’s live 3D image guidance helps to improve the technical success of the procedure, as it can automatically identify the small tumor-feeders that are difficult to detect with conventional 2D angiographic imaging methods,” Miyayama added.
See – EmboGuide leverages the ultra-low X-ray dose settings of Philips’ AlluraClarity interventional X-ray system and the fast, high quality imaging of the abdomen of XperCT Dual. XperCT Dual’s enhanced imaging technique (multiphase cone beam CT) offers high quality 3D images of lesions, with proven detection accuracy superior to conventional 2D angiographic imaging. It offers clinicians a better view of the treatment targets for informed decision making while performing the procedure. XperCT Dual is comparable to MRI, which is considered to be the ‘gold standard’, according to Koninklijke Philips N.V.
Reach – EmboGuide helps to define the tumor lesions and features automatic identification of blood vessels that feed the lesions. It detects more than twice as many tumor feeding arteries compared to conventional imaging methods (Digital Subtraction Angiography (DSA) [1]. This allows interventional radiologists to optimize the catheter locations for embolization and plan a route to them. During the administration of the embolization agent, EmboGuide accurately superimposes the planning information onto the interventional X-ray system’s live images to monitor the treatment progress and determine its endpoint.
